Castellated beams are created by precision-cutting and welding traditional steel I-beams into a staggered pattern with distinctive hexagonal openings—boosting depth and strength while reducing weight.

Benefits of Castellated Beams

Performance Snapshot

Span capability:
beams can be extended up to 100+ ft. 

Depth capability:
depth can be increased up to 66 in. 

Sustainability note:
up to 40% more moment-carrying capacity using no extra steel, supporting a lower material footprint.
